The modern enterprise operates within a state of permanent volatility. In this environment, characterized by rapid technological shifts and eroding skill half-lives, the traditional focus on static competence is no longer sufficient to sustain competitive advantage. Organizations are increasingly recognizing that the foundational driver of long-term success is not merely the possession of specific technical skills but the presence of grit: a psychological construct defined by perseverance and passion for long-term goals. The integration of advanced Learning Management Systems (LMS) and Learning Experience Platforms (LXP) has evolved from a mechanism for compliance into a strategic engine for fostering this resilience. By leveraging AI-driven personalization, immersive simulations, and social accountability frameworks, digital ecosystems provide the infrastructure necessary for deliberate practice and sustained effort in the face of adversity. This analysis examines the mechanics of how corporate learning platforms transform individual persistence into organizational agility.
The concept of grit has transcended its origins in developmental psychology to become a critical variable in human capital strategy. Research indicates that grit serves as a significant predictor of success across challenging domains, often outweighing innate talent or intelligence. For the modern enterprise, understanding the internal motivational pathways of gritty individuals is essential for designing effective development programs. The personal meaning or self-reflected purpose that an employee attributes to their success determines the volume of job demands they are willing to undertake. When goals are perceived as meaningful, motivational intensity increases, allowing individuals to overcome significant hurdles.
This motivational drive often operates as an autonomic process that occurs unconsciously through internal pathways that sustain effort over years. In a corporate context, this aligns with adult learning theories that emphasize the importance of self-efficacy and metacognition. Metacognitive self-talk has been identified as a vital tool for developing grit, helping employees overcome barriers in goal-directed action. Furthermore, grit is strongly correlated with increased professional well-being, better mental health, and higher levels of engagement. For organizations, this means that fostering a gritty culture is not just about productivity but about creating a sustainable and healthy work environment.

The global economy is currently facing a dual challenge: a critical shortage of technical skills and a widening experience gap. While a vast majority of workers are ready to learn new skills or completely retrain, organizations continue to struggle with finding talent that possesses the practical experience required for modern roles. Data indicates that a significant percentage of managers find recent hires unprepared for the demands of their work, with a lack of experience being the most common failing. This has led many employers to increase experience requirements, even for entry-level roles, further complicating the talent acquisition landscape.
The distinction between a skills gap and an experience gap is crucial. A skills gap refers to the absence of specific knowledge or technical abilities, whereas an experience gap refers to the inability to apply those skills in complex, real-world contexts. While technical skills can often be acquired relatively quickly through formal training, developing the uniquely human skills such as complex problem solving, teamwork, and leadership requires time and immersion. Executives are increasingly concerned about these behavioral gaps. While many worry about digital skills, human resources leaders report that graduates often have the necessary tech fluency but lack business understanding and collaborative competence.
The pressure on organizations to close this gap is compounded by a two-edged labor market. While there are severe shortages in hourly and blue-collar sectors, white-collar workers are facing increased competition and fears regarding the impact of artificial intelligence on their career trajectories. Approximately three-quarters of employees express concern that AI will negatively impact their jobs, yet business leaders recognize that AI adoption is essential for future productivity. In this context, upskilling is not merely an educational initiative. It is a mechanism for maintaining stability and resilience in a workforce that feels increasingly vulnerable.
To address these challenges, the technological infrastructure of corporate learning is undergoing a fundamental transformation. The traditional Learning Management System (LMS), primarily designed for administrative push learning and compliance tracking, is being augmented or replaced by the Learning Experience Platform (LXP). While the LMS focuses on formal training and records, the LXP is designed to pull learners in by offering personalized, informal, and social learning experiences. This shift reflects a move toward human-focused design, placing the individual at the center of the learning process.
The LXP architecture is built on three core pillars: creation, curation, and collaboration. This allows employees not only to consume content but to contribute their own knowledge, fostering a culture of peer-to-peer expert discovery. Modern platforms leverage AI to deliver adaptive learning paths, microlearning modules, and gamified experiences that enhance motivation and knowledge retention.
Digital learning ecosystems now prioritize growth in the flow of work. This concept involves integrating learning opportunities directly into the software and workflows employees use daily. By reducing the friction between working and learning, organizations can encourage continuous skill development without requiring employees to disconnect from their primary duties. This integration is vital for building organizational resilience, as it allows for the rapid dissemination of knowledge and the agile reallocation of talent in response to market shifts.
The classic 70-20-10 model posits that 70% of learning comes from experiential on-the-job challenges, 20% from social interactions, and 10% from formal education. In the digital era, this model is not becoming obsolete but is being radically operationalized by technology. Modern learning ecosystems are blurring the lines between these categories, making the 70% and 20% more accessible and measurable than ever before.
Digital platforms facilitate the experiential 70% by offering gig marketplaces or internal mobility hubs where employees can find stretch assignments that align with their learning goals. The social 20% is enhanced through integrated communication tools that allow learners to tag experts, share insights, and form communities of practice within the flow of their daily tasks. This digital restructuring ensures that learning is continuous and context-aware rather than episodic and isolated.
At the heart of grit-driven upskilling is the principle of deliberate practice, the systematic and repetitive effort required to master complex skills. Traditional one-size-fits-all training models are ill-suited for this, as they often fail to account for the diverse backgrounds and learning paces of a modern workforce. Adaptive learning software addresses this by using AI and machine learning to adjust the content, pacing, and feedback for each individual in real time.
The mechanics of adaptive learning are designed to optimize the zone of proximal development, ensuring that challenges are neither too easy, which leads to boredom, nor too difficult, which leads to frustration. By assessing current knowledge through continuous quizzes and activities, the system identifies specific gaps and provides personalized resources to bridge them. This approach has been shown to foster deeper mastery and improve post-test scores compared to baseline LMS models.
Furthermore, adaptive systems empower employees to take ownership of their learning journeys. This sense of autonomy is a core component of Self-Determination Theory, which suggests that individuals are most motivated when they feel in control of their behavior, competent in their actions, and related to others. When gamification mechanics, such as point scoring, badges, and leaderboards, are aligned with these psychological needs, they can drive a significant increase in participation. However, the key to successful implementation is ensuring that gamification is used to support competence and relatedness rather than simply creating external pressure.
While grit is often viewed as an individual trait, its development within an organization is frequently a social process. Cohort-based learning, which involves groups of learners progressing through training simultaneously, has emerged as a powerful model for fostering resilience and accountability. By moving through a program together, employees form a community that provides emotional and academic support, leading to completion rates significantly higher than non-cohort models.
The shared journey in a cohort creates a sense of mutual accountability that spurs participants to meet deadlines and track their progress more rigorously than they would in isolation. This social pressure acts as a positive force that accelerates the adoption of new practices and skills. For the organization, cohort learning strengthens the muscle that enables teams to perform with excellence, facilitating the transfer of knowledge from senior leadership to frontline employees through meaningful conversation and storytelling.
Technology plays a critical role in scaling these initiatives. Purpose-built platforms can automate enrollment, facilitate group interactions, and provide managers with insights into team engagement. This is particularly important as the demand for authentic human connection grows in an increasingly AI-driven landscape. Even as organizations invest in AI to make training faster and cheaper, they must recognize that shared learning is essential for both employee growth and business performance.
To address the experience gap specifically, organizations are turning to immersive technologies such as Virtual Reality (VR), Augmented Reality (AR), and Mixed Reality (MR). These tools offer hands-on, scalable training solutions that traditional methods cannot match, providing risk-free environments for employees to practice high-stakes tasks. By simulating real-world challenges, immersive learning bridges the gap between theoretical knowledge and practical application, making the transition from the classroom to the job much more effective.
The effectiveness of these technologies is particularly evident in fields like healthcare and manufacturing, where precision and safety are paramount. For instance, VR allows nursing students to practice complex procedures like needle insertion or heart anatomy without touching a patient, building confidence and competence before entering a clinical setting. Beyond technical skills, immersive communication training using AI avatars allows employees to coordinate and converse in simulated environments, enhancing their leadership and problem-solving abilities without the need for cumbersome hardware in every instance.
The return on investment for immersive learning is maximized when technical architecture is paired with compelling, engaging content. As these tools become more accessible, they will play a vital role in creating Superworkers, employees who are augmented by technology to perform at levels previously reserved for highly experienced specialists.
While grit is a desirable trait, its promotion within an organization carries inherent risks. Excessive grit can lead to burnout, characterized by physical and emotional exhaustion, especially when employees are encouraged to push through systemic issues or unsupportive environments. This phenomenon, often termed dark grit, occurs when the passion and perseverance that fuel resilience become maladaptive, leading to health deterioration and high turnover rates.
Organizations must recognize that grit is not a substitute for fair wages, safe working conditions, or effective leadership. For marginalized groups, the demand for increased resilience can mask deeper systemic problems such as economic inequality or discrimination. To manage this, L&D platforms are increasingly integrating wellness and mental health support into their design. This includes providing self-paced learning options, wellness check-ins, and reminders for healthy usage to reduce cognitive overload.
Leadership plays a pivotal role in preventing burnout. Effective managers encourage employees to take care of their mental health and respect time off. By fostering a culture of psychological safety where employees feel empowered to speak up, organizations can ensure that the pursuit of grit remains a positive and sustainable endeavor. Tools that offer "focus time" and "quiet modes" within the digital workplace help protect employees from the constant barrage of notifications, allowing for deep work and recovery.
The business value of upskilling and resilience programs must be demonstrated through data-backed metrics. While traditional metrics like completion rates remain common, organizations are shifting toward more sophisticated indicators of business impact, such as internal mobility, skill retention, and productivity improvements. The ROI of training can be quantified by examining the cost savings associated with reduced turnover and the revenue growth driven by enhanced employee performance.
Organizations that invest in career development and upskilling see a measurable impact on retention. Career-related reasons are a leading cause of turnover; those who feel supported through learning are significantly more likely to stay. Furthermore, upskilling initiatives are consistently found to create tangible value for the business. Metrics such as the Course Net Promoter Score (NPS) and stakeholder perception provide qualitative insights into the effectiveness of L&D programs, while tracking the application of new skills on the job offers a measure of learning transfer. Robust LMS and LXP systems are essential for gathering this data, allowing leaders to align training efforts with high-level business objectives like productivity and profitability.
Financial Services: Accelerating Transformation through Specialized Colleges
In the financial sector, where legacy systems and evolving regulations create constant pressure for modernization, leaders are investing heavily in internal upskilling. One prominent global financial institution established a specialized technology college to provide its 50,000+ associates with access to thousands of courses on critical technologies like Python, cloud architecture, and machine learning. This program reduced external hiring needs and resulted in a double-digit increase in the retention of in-demand tech roles. By focusing on internal talent, the organization expedited team productivity, with employees passing certification exams significantly faster than previous averages.
Healthcare: Building Resilience in a Stretched Workforce
The healthcare industry faces unique challenges, including an aging population, caregiver retirements, and post-pandemic exhaustion. Hospitals are increasingly investing in AI and digital skills development to alleviate the administrative burden on frontline staff. Resilience training, often delivered through web apps and virtual modules, has shown positive effects in helping nurses and physicians understand their stress responses and implement coping strategies. Studies on healthcare keyworkers found that digital resilience training helped participants understand stress and made them likely to take action to develop their resilience. These interventions provide exponential benefits at the community level, upholding the delivery of safer, higher-quality care.
Technology: Pivoting from Know-it-All to Learn-it-All
Technology giants have historically struggled with the dual identity of being innovators while maintaining operational discipline. A notable cultural transformation occurred at a leading global software firm where the leadership shifted the organizational mindset from a "know-it-all" culture to a "learn-it-all" culture. This shift promoted lifelong learning and cooperation, leading to a substantial increase in employee satisfaction over nearly a decade. Similarly, a centuries-old manufacturing company successfully transformed its IT department by integrating the principle that performance is directly correlated with employee engagement. By establishing positive reinforcement mechanisms, the organization created a sustainable framework that balances autonomous team structures with high operational excellence.
